A Simple Recipe for Cookie Connoisseurs

Don’t worry if you’re not an experienced baker – making Mexican Pink Sugar Cookies is easier than you might think. Here’s a simple recipe to help you whip up a batch of these delightful treats in no time:

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ened

  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

  • Pink food coloring
  • Additional granulated sugar, for rolling

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Stir in the vanilla extract and gradually add the flour and salt until well combined.
  4. Add a few drops of pink food coloring, mixing until the dough reaches your desired shade of pink.
  5. Roll the dough into small, rounded balls, approximately 1-inch in diameter.
  6. Roll each ball in additional granulated sugar, ensuring they’re fully coated.
  7. Place the sugared dough balls on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
  8. Gently press each cookie down with the bottom of a glass to flatten slightly.
  9.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den.
  10.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Cinnamon: The Versatile Spice

One of the key spices in Mexican cookies is cinnamon. This warm and aromatic spice adds a cozy and comforting flavor to the cookies. Whether it’s the crispy edges of a sugar cookie or the crumbly texture of a Mexican wedding cookie (also known as polvorones), cinnamon brings a sense of warmth and depth to these tasty treats.

Ancho Chili: A Fiery Surprise

If you’re feeling adventurous, some Mexican cookies take the spice game to the next level by incorporating ancho chili powder. This smoky and mildly spicy chili adds a surprising kick that complements the sweetness of the cookies. Don’t worry, though, they won’t leave you reaching for a glass of water – the heat is just enough to give your taste buds a playful tingle.
